POS票据logo
项目描述
POS票据logo
在POS票据中添加公司logo
动机
`XmlReceipt` Qweb报告在`iface_print_via_proxy`配置为`True`时使用:[链接](https://github.com/odoo/odoo/blob/8.0/addons/point_of_sale/static/src/js/screens.js#L1341)
但如果是`iface_print_via_proxy`配置为`False`的情况,使用`PosTicket` Qweb报告,并且不使用company_logo:[链接](https://github.com/odoo/odoo/blob/8.0/addons/point_of_sale/static/src/js/screens.js#L984)
另一方面,使用`/web/binary/company_logo`控制器加载company_logo,该控制器返回150px宽的logo:[链接](https://github.com/odoo/odoo/blob/8.0/addons/point_of_sale/static/src/js/models.js#L371),但在之后logo被调整到300px宽,所以即使原始logo是300px宽,也会出现像素化的logo。这就是我们覆盖company_logo加载方式的原因。我们还将其调整为260px宽(而不是300px),因为在PDF中显示时会截断
致谢
贡献者
Antonio Espinosa <antonioea@antiun.com>
Endika Iglesias <endikaig@antiun.com>
维护者
本模块由OCA维护。
OCA,即Odoo社区协会,是一个非营利组织,其使命是支持Odoo功能的协作开发并推广其广泛使用。
要为此模块做出贡献,请访问http://odoo-community.org。
项目详情
哈希值 for odoo8_addon_pos_ticket_logo-8.0.1.0.0-py2-none-any.whl
算法 | 哈希摘要 | |
---|---|---|
SHA256 | ee0cdd2c11dc2a0e06323239fcc0e73dc6bcb4719d4c830db08d7562ef6d4726 |
|
MD5 | 85680c3485467154cb6d6452c19c538e |
|
BLAKE2b-256 | 7bf2b0e6c433247f60e6b659abdce0cc07e05ccc058d27da220444462f6d602d |